The regulator bought $140 million on the interbank forex market last week.
The National Bank of Ukraine on April 1-5 resumed currency sales on the interbank foreign exchange market after a two-week break, having sold US$21.6 million.

At the same time, the regulator bought $140 million on the interbank forex market. As a result, the National Bank's currency purchases exceeded its sales by $118.4 million, according to the NBU's website.
Since the year-start, the central bank has bought on the interbank market $743.18 million more than it sold, the report said.
UNIAN memo. The National Bank in 2018 replenished reserves on the interbank forex market by $1.372 billion.
